1998 BMW 317 vs. 1963 Cadillac 62
To start off, 1998 BMW 317 is newer by 35 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1963 Cadillac 62.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1963 Cadillac 62 would be higher. At 6,390 cc (8 cylinders), 1963 Cadillac 62 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1963 Cadillac 62 (197 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 108 more horse power than 1998 BMW 317. (89 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1963 Cadillac 62 should accelerate faster than 1998 BMW 317.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1963 Cadillac 62 weights approximately 735 kg more than 1998 BMW 317.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
